Private and Peaceful Living with Superb Entertaining Appeal Surrounded by Lush Greenery in Cosmopolitan City-Fringe Locale

Spanning across three beautifully appointed levels and delivering seamless transitions between generous outdoor areas and elegant interiors, this impeccably presented north-facing townhouse provides ample space for bustling family life and sophisticated entertaining.

Soaring 3.8m ceilings grace an open living and dining area that opens fully onto a generous, protected courtyard fringed with greenery, while a versatile mezzanine-level media room or casual sitting room opens onto a sunny north-facing balcony.

A well-scaled contemporary gourmet kitchen boasts integrated stainless-steel Miele appliances, abundant storage space and wide Corian waterfall benchtops with a breakfast bar.

Three good-sized bedrooms with built-in wardrobes and cleverly designed glazing occupy the upper level. Two have practical built-in study spaces, while the main has a deluxe ensuite and flows out to a private sunlit balcony with a leafy outlook. A versatile fourth bedroom is located on the entrance level.

The luxurious main bathroom features a rimless shower and separate tub, while the large laundry houses a glass-framed shower, with a separate guest powder room and ample storage. The entire house captures natural light through full height bifold doors and well-positioned skylights.

A tandem lock-up garage with internal access completes the layout of this sensational residence, positioned at the end of a quiet cul-de-sac with several of Sydney's best galleries, chic eateries, popular pubs, lush parks and a choice of schools within a 700m radius.
